Key Features of 5G

    5G technology boasts several key features that set it apart from its predecessors. One of the most notable aspects of 5G is its significantly higher data transfer speeds, enabling users to download and upload content at blazing-fast rates. Additionally, 5G offers low latency, ensuring minimal delays in data transmission, which is critical for applications that require real-time responsiveness. Moreover, 5G networks have the capacity to support a vast number of connected devices simultaneously, paving the way for the widespread adoption of IoT devices and applications.

Applications of 5G Technology

    The potential applications of 5G technology are vast and diverse. From powering the Internet of Things (IoT) to revolutionizing mobile experiences, 5G has the potential to transform various industries. In the realm of IoT, 5G enables seamless connectivity between devices, facilitating the exchange of data and enabling the development of smart homes, cities, and infrastructure. Moreover, 5G enhances mobile experiences by enabling high-definition streaming, immersive gaming, and augmented reality (AR) applications on mobile devices. Furthermore, 5G technology is driving advancements in industrial automation and smart cities, enabling more efficient operations and enhancing quality of life for residents.

Impact on Various Industries

    5G technology is poised to have a profound impact on various industries, revolutionizing the way businesses operate and individuals interact with technology. In the healthcare sector, 5G enables remote patient monitoring, telemedicine services, and real-time data transmission, facilitating faster diagnoses and improving patient outcomes. In transportation, 5G powers connected vehicles and autonomous driving technologies, enhancing road safety and efficiency. Additionally, in the entertainment industry, 5G enables high-quality streaming, immersive gaming experiences, and virtual reality (VR) content delivery, ushering in a new era of entertainment consumption.

Challenges and Concerns

    Despite its transformative potential, the widespread deployment of 5G technology is not without challenges and concerns. One of the primary challenges is the infrastructure requirements needed to support 5G networks, including the installation of new base stations and antennas. Additionally, security and privacy issues related to the vast amount of data transmitted over 5G networks pose significant concerns, necessitating robust cybersecurity measures and regulatory frameworks to safeguard user information.
